Damping minimizes overshoot and oscillation and also reduces response time. Standard damping will fit most applications. Double damping reduces the response time even further by more slowly approaching the final position. Damping options can be specified when ordering.
If the index option is selected the encoder should be oriented as shown below.
B leads A for clockwise rotation and A leads B for counter-clockwise rotation of the inclinometer (viewed from the encoder cover side of the inclinometer).
